Does your child ever feel like they don't fit in?
Toby the Big Little Yorkie knows how that feels. At fifteen pounds, he's larger than most Yorkies, so he can't ride in purses or wear tiny sweaters that other Yorkies love. A playful bundle of energy, Toby enjoys being outdoors, chasing sticks, and getting muddy.
But Toby soon learns that being different is hard. When other dogs tease him, and people laugh at his size, he wonders, Is something wrong with me?
With his best friend Charlie by his side, Toby begins to see the world through kinder eyes. Charlie helps him realize the things that make him different also make him special.
Toby the Big Little Yorkie is a heartwarming story about friendship, confidence, and the joy of celebrating what makes you unique. Toby shows us that being different isn't something to hide; it's something to wag about, because the best thing you can be is YOU
Perfect for children ages 4-8, Toby the Big Little Yorkie is a heartwarming tale about friendship, courage, and learning to love yourself-exactly as you are.
